        Apaprently BEA and IBM have pulled together some extensions for 
J2EE app servers which they intend to implement and propose as JSRs.  
Probably worth keeping in the back of our mind.

http://news.com.com/2100-7345-5111567.html?tag=nl

        Particularly:

"The three technical specifications are these: Service Data Objects, which 
provides a common way to pull data from multiple data sources, such as 
Extensible Markup Language-based file systems and relational databases; 
Timer for Application Servers, a mechanism for scheduling processing jobs; 
and Work Manager for Application Servers, for setting up processing tasks 
in parallel."
